VC开发技术
z_m_r168168
这个作者很懒,什么都没留下…
展开
-
使用ADO实现vc中二进制文件数据的存取(以图像在数据库中的存取为例)
1、保存图片数据到数据库以下是代码片段:查看源代码 拷贝至剪贴板 打印代码1. //JPG图片保存到数据库 2. try 3. { 4. _RecordsetPtr pRecordset; 5.转载 2012-04-25 13:14:44 · 828 阅读 · 0 评论 -
如何在VC++编译器中进行编译选项配置
一.IDE基础配置 3 B9 E( @' U/ \9 f1. 字体 VC6中“Tools→Options→Format→Font”配置字体;VC2005中“工具→选项→环境→字体和颜色”配置字体。1 X5 B2 k) F$ \& T# C2 }. ?编写代码一般采用等宽字体,等宽点阵(位图)字体,相对矢量字体而言具有兼容性好和显示清晰的优点。常用的编程等宽字体包括Fixedsys(转载 2012-04-19 13:51:08 · 4237 阅读 · 0 评论 -
vc6如何取远程WEB页内容
1.申请头文件 #include 2.在任意一个按钮增加如要代码 //让控件和对应的变量之间进行数据交换,现在将控件数据传给对应变量 UpdateData(true); //m_SiteInfo为控件ID_EDIT_CONTENT读应的变量 CString m_SiteInfo=""; CString m_SiteName;原创 2012-04-18 18:55:41 · 439 阅读 · 0 评论 -
vc6如何编写让外部应用调用的DLL
1.在vc6中创建一个win32或mfc dll项目mfcdll2.在cpp中增加函数add(int a, int b){ return a +b;}3.创建一个def文件,在里定义导出函数; mfcdll.def : Declares the module parameters for the DLL.LIBRARY "mfcdll"DES原创 2012-04-18 21:01:21 · 624 阅读 · 0 评论 -
VC6.0编译器参数设置说明
VC6.0编译器参数的设置主要通过VC的菜单项Project->Settings->C/C++页来完成。我们可以看到这一页的最下面Project Options中的内容,一般如下:/nologo /MDd /W3 /Gm /GX /ZI /Od /D "WIN32" /D "_DEBUG" /D "_WINDOWS" /D "_AFXDLL" /D "_MBCS" /Fp"Debug/Wr转载 2012-04-18 19:02:17 · 734 阅读 · 0 评论 -
vc6如何读写xml
在cpp中增加#import "msxml.dll" rename_namespace("MSXML")-----这几名一定要加否则报错,表示以COM形式调用所以要初始化一下COM---------- AfxEnableControlContainer(); ::AfxOleInit(); ::CoInitialize(NULL);因为是com操作原创 2012-04-18 18:58:29 · 1423 阅读 · 0 评论 -
vc6调用dll的几种方式
一.隐式调用1.在project set中和link tab页增加lib文件,多个文件用空格隔开2.增加一个头文件 #include "nterface.h",并把头文件增加到引用的cpp中,对lib中函数进行申明如dll有个函数add 头文件申明格式如下 int APIENTRY add(int a,int b);3.在窗口增加一个按钮事件增加如下代码 void C原创 2012-04-18 18:53:51 · 1014 阅读 · 0 评论 -
vc6如何调用WEBSERVICE
1.创建一个VC项目,创建一个类代码如下-----------WSWrapper.h----------------------------------------------------------------------------// WSWrapper.h: interface for the WSWrapper class.//////////////////////转载 2012-04-18 18:42:52 · 695 阅读 · 0 评论 -
vc6连接各种数据库
说明:本人测试是在xp下,开始连接sql2005是总是连接不上,网上查了下,有说什么用户设置问题,还有的说同ntwdblib.DLL版本问题,都不行,最后经过很多试验终于搞定注意的是sql2005及以上的dbms(ZHONGYH01\SQL2005)在中间要加两个斜杠否则报错的 #import "msado15.dll" no_namespace rename("EOF","adoE原创 2012-04-26 16:41:55 · 521 阅读 · 0 评论 -
VC6.0中使用Stream Object读取数据中流文件并显示Bmp,JPG等图片
VC6.0中使用Stream Object读取数据中流文件并显示Bmp,JPG等图片 在VC6.0中我们通常用Ado的Field 对象的GetChuck和AppendChunk来读写Blob对象,但是这样做要写很多的代码,其实ado给我们提供了一个更易操作的对象那就是 Stream Object,通过它我们可以更容易的操作数据库中的Blob对象,而且可以直接把Bl转载 2012-04-25 13:35:23 · 668 阅读 · 0 评论 -
vc编译器简介
大家可能一直在用VC开发软件,但是对于这个编译器却未必很了解。原因是多方面的。大多数情况下,我们只停留在“使用”它,而不会想去“了解”它。因为它只是一个工具,我们宁可把更多的精力放在C++语言和软件设计上。我们习惯于这样一种“模式”:建立一个项目,然后写代码,然后编译,反反复复调试。但是,所谓:“公欲善其事,必先利其器”。如果我们精于VC开发环境,我们是不是能够做得更加游刃有余呢?6 f K转载 2012-04-19 13:54:53 · 781 阅读 · 0 评论